Job Description
Join InnovateTech Solutions, a cutting-edge software development firm revolutionizing the Central Valley's tech landscape. We're seeking passionate Entry Level Software Engineers to build scalable applications and accelerate your career in a collaborative, mentor-driven environment. Enjoy competitive benefits, flexible work arrangements, and opportunities to work on projects impacting real-world communities.
Responsibilities
- Develop and maintain high-quality code for web and mobile applications
- Collaborate with cross-functional teams using Agile methodologies
- Debug and optimize software performance across multiple platforms
- Participate in code reviews and contribute to technical documentation
- Learn and implement emerging technologies like cloud computing and DevOps
- Support deployment cycles and monitor application health
Qualifications
- Bachelor's degree in Computer Science or related field (or equivalent experience)
- Proficiency in at least one programming language (Java, Python, or JavaScript)
- Understanding of data structures, algorithms, and OOP principles
- Familiarity with version control systems (Git) and CI/CD pipelines
- Ability to work in fast-paced environments with minimal supervision
- Strong problem-solving skills and attention to detail